European ISPs will be closely monitored to ensure net neutrality rules due late May are properly implemented and adhered to, the European Commission warns. It has called for communications regulator BEREC to report any barriers to switching provider or accessing content, and failures to advertise real data rates.
 
Figures showing a 13.4% rise in global business intelligence and performance management software revenues to $10.5 billion (€7.2 billion) in 2010 highlight the importance of a sector that has consistently exceeded IT budget growth Gartner analyst Dan Sommer states.

Australian cellco Optus has awarded a multi-million dollar network upgrade contract to Nokia Siemens, as it seeks to deploy LTE to meet growing demand for data services.
